forgot to mention that hards, cactus and freak are permanently unavailable...

hards was the captain/coach in our very first forum footy game. He played up front and led us to victory against the sainters.

Up to then, the sainters had dominated forum footy. Thanks to hards, doggo, cactus, freak and many others, we dees have dominated forum footy since 2005.

Freak was the first of our run and carry guys. His controversial goal against the sainters set up the demonland dominance. Then, we called it demonland/demonology.

Just 3 seasons ago, we ran out of challengers and demonland played demonology, with a narrow victory to demonland. Given the recent demise of demonolgy, this will never happen again.

Cactus was perhaps the best player to ever play for us. An agressive forward, he averaged 4 goals a game. I remember one game (it might have been 2008) when coach redleg banished cactus to the backline after half-time because we we so far ahead...

Best wises to these 3 guys...

I hope the current batch of playeres can keep up the tradition, and make their own history...

I have agreed with scotty21, the bomberblitz organiser, that the team that has to play two games in a row is at a real disadvantage.

Last year, we played the dons and won.

But then we had to take on the pies with only a 10-minute break.

The "pies" consisted of a dozen fresh players, supplemented by the best players from bomberblitz.

We lost that game, and only won the day on percentage.

So, this year, the umpys will supervise the toss of a coin to see which of the 3 teams has to play 2 in a row.

    The Casey Demons have broken the ice for season 2024 with a pulsating come-from-behind victory over Port Melbourne in which it took the lead for the first time at the halfway mark of the final quarter. The game played in mild Autumn conditions in neutral territory at Kinetic Park, Frankston, never reached great heights in standard but it proved gripping in character at the end at the Casey Demons overcame the Borough to win by 15 points after trailing badly early in the second half.  P

    The writing was on the wall from the very first bounce of the football. The big men went up, Max Gawn more often than not, decisively won the ruck hit out and invariably a Brisbane Lions onballer either won the battle on the ground or halved the contest and they went at it repeatedly until they finally won out. Melbourne managed the first goal from Alex Neal-Bullen but after that the visitors shut out every area of Demon presence around the ground except in the ruck duels. It was a mauling.
